简介
# 一、简介
OAuthLogin —— 一款有点好用但是难配置的登陆插件
本插件基于OAuth协议登陆(例如 QQ 登录),彻底告别什么乱七八遭的问题,开小号,密码等什么烦心玩意

# 二、使用
# 2.1、必要条件
- 有自己的机器或者租赁的VPS机器,可自由申请开放端口的
- 有自己的域名(可选备案)
- 懂网站搭建的,了解nginx转发域名的
- 有一定开发者知识能看懂下面的教程
# 2.2、在config中配置
# 服务器端口
port: 8888
# oauth 信息
source: 'qq'
clientId: '申请的clientId'
clientSecret: '申请的clientSecret'
redirectUri: 'https://域名/open/oauth/callback/QQ'
点击查看: 支持第三方登录列表 (opens new window)
# 以下按照 QQ 互联举例
点击查看: QQ互连 (opens new window)
# 2.3、port 如何配置
用于服务端对外暴露的接口,配置任意一个服务器未被占用的端口即可
# 2.4、clientId/clientSecret/redirectUri 参数如何配置
# 三、前置插件
都是非必须
PlaceholderAPI PAPI变量
PlaceholderAPI (opens new window)
ProtocolLib 协议库
ProtocolLib (opens new window)